      Yes I did, but I got this one brand new for less than half of the price of either turntable so it was a no-brainer.

    • @Building_America
      @Building_America  7 лет назад

      The Ross turntable is very smooth and the quality of the build it excellent the only drawback is the size, it is very large and takes up a good bid of space.

      Hello Theo, the roundhouse is by Korber and I had it custom built by Allan Graziano. I would love to be able to show you the track plan but the layout has come down. If you look at some of my videos you should be able to see how built the layout. I can tell you that you need at least 5 inches from the turntable to the roundhouse. If you are running larger engines like Big Boys make sure you leave enough space on the approach to the turntable for the engine to straighten out.     Firehawk the way I'm understanding it the ross turntable is all preprogrammed stop points? And your whisker tracks have to be lined up with the table. Unlike the mill house turntable where you program the the table to line up how ever you want it?

    • @Building_America
      @Building_America  4 года назад +1

      The is 1000% correct! It is also one of the reasons why I am changing to the Millhouse turntable with my new layout.
